About Kitron
Kitron is a leading Scandinavian Electronics Manufacturing Services (EMS) company, delivering improved flexibility, cost efficiency, and innovation power through the value chain. The company has operations in Norway, Sweden, Denmark, Lithuania, Germany, Poland, the Czech Republic, India, China, Malaysia, and the United States. With 2500 highly skilled employees, Kitron manufactures and delivers anything from fully assembled electronic circuit boards to complete end - products for customers globally. Related technical services like prototyping, industrialisation, material analysing and test development are also key competencies offered by Kitron.

Job Description:
Vendor Identification & Development:
- Identify and develop new suppliers, ensuring they meet quality, cost, and lead-time requirements.
- Manage relationships with key suppliers and ensure consistent supply chain performance.
- Lead vendor development activities, including quality assessments, audits, and performance reviews
Component Sourcing & Development:
- Lead sourcing initiatives for mechanical commodities such as Sheet Metal, Machining, Stamping, and Plastic components.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ure component specifications, quality, and cost targets are met.
- Conduct technical reviews of part designs and engineering specifications to ensure suitability for production.
- Analyse customer data to ensure mechanical parts suitability for production and determine best quoting strategy during RFQ.
- Oversee new HLA implementation in to manufacturing process.
Costing & Negotiation:
- Drive cost negotiation processes with suppliers to secure the best possible pricing for components.
- Use expertise in cost analysis, including labor, material, and tooling costs, to ensure cost-effective sourcing decisions.
- Implement cost reduction initiatives using Value Analysis and Value Engineering (VAVE) techniques to optimize product cost while maintaining quality and functionality.
- Estimate HLA cost based on materials, labour, production methods, and other relevant factors.
- Identify potential issues or cost-saving opportunities for HLA parts.
Compliance & Standards:
- Ensure all sourced components and suppliers comply with international quality standards (ISO, AS), regulatory requirements, and company policies.
- Keep abreast of industry trends and best practices in sourcing and supply chain management, applying knowledge to optimize sourcing strategies
Requirements:
- B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ering, Manufacturing, Supply Chain Management, or a related field
- 5 to 8 years of experience in sourcing mechanical commodities (Sheet Metal, Machining, Stamping, Plastics) in EMS industries. (Aerospace, Defence, Medical and Industrial sectors)
- Very good understanding of manufacturing processes like above.
- Proven track record of vendor identification, development, and management in complex mechanical component sourcing.
- Additional certifications in supply chain management (e.g., Six Sigma, APICS, etc.) are a plus.
- Proficiency in CAD software.
- Familiar with ERP system like SAP, IFS, computer office skill.
- Good Strategic and analytical skill.
- Excellent interpersonal skills, negotiation, and presentation skills.
- Excellent teamwork skills –ability to work in cross-functional groups, preferably multi-national.
- Able to communicate effectively in English on a technical level.
